Table Of Content
1. Introduction to the law of contractPart I Formation2. Agreement3. Agreement problems4. Enforceability of promises: consideration and promissory estoppel5. Intention to be legally bound, formalities and capacity to contractPart II Content, interpretation, performance, and breach6. Content of the contract and principles of interpretation7. Exemption clauses and unfair contract terms8. Breach of contractPart III Enforcement of contractual obligations9. Damages for breach of contract10. Remedies providing for specific relief and restitutionary remedies11. Privity of contract and third party rights12. Discharge by frustration: subsequent impossibilityPart IV Methods of policing the making of the contract13. Non-agreement mistake14. Misrepresentation15. Duress, undue influence, and unconscionable bargains16. Illegality
Synopsis
Jill Poole's immensely popular Textbook on Contract Law has been guiding students through contract law for many years. The accessible writing style and focus on key principles and developments in contract law make this text a favourite with students and lecturers alike. The author places the law of contract clearly within its wider context before proceeding to provide detailed yet accessible treatment of all the key areas encountered when studying contract law.
